Output 6ebca081562abc3fb3c80cc6199c5cb861c49cac8d6c4691f71fe9cf19fd7bc4:0

value
595084469
script pubkey
OP_0 OP_PUSHBYTES_20 f6b97d7b29107da9ea3b2473d2d43aeefc46a4ca
address
bc1q76uh67efzp76n63my3ea94p6am7ydfx2ljen3z
transaction
6ebca081562abc3fb3c80cc6199c5cb861c49cac8d6c4691f71fe9cf19fd7bc4
spent
true